- Winspace T1500 carbon frame, Size Medium
build Tough one piece aero carbon bars 40mm bars 110mm stem
Sram Force AXS etap HRD groupset
Hyper 50mm carbon wheels
Complete build with Time pedals, computer mount, Selle Italia SLR saddle 8.16 kg - Sport
